4-Aminophenol: A Versatile Chromophore Precursor
4-Aminophenol, an organic compound with the formula C6H7NO, is highly valued in the dye industry for its reactive amino and hydroxyl groups. These functional groups allow it to participate in various chemical reactions, making it an ideal intermediate for synthesizing a wide spectrum of colors. Its primary applications include the production of:
- Azo Dyes: 4-Aminophenol is a common coupling component or diazo component in the synthesis of many azo dyes, which are known for their brilliant colors and wide applicability in textiles and printing inks.
- Sulfur Dyes: It is an intermediate in the manufacture of sulfur dyes, particularly for achieving dark shades like blues and blacks on cotton fabrics, offering good wash fastness.
- Acid Dyes: The compound contributes to the creation of acid dyes, used for dyeing wool, silk, nylon, and modified acrylic fibers.
- Fur Dyes: It is also employed in the formulation of dyes for fur and leather, providing effective coloration and finishing.
Beyond its direct use in dye synthesis, 4-Aminophenol can also serve as a precursor for other dye intermediates, further expanding its influence in the colorants market. Its ability to form stable chromophores makes it a reliable choice for manufacturers seeking consistent color performance.
Sourcing High-Quality 4-Aminophenol for Dye Production
When procuring 4-Aminophenol for dye and pigment manufacturing, quality and consistency are paramount. Manufacturers require a product with a reliable purity level, typically ≥98.0%, to ensure predictable reaction outcomes and vibrant, stable colors. Impurities can lead to off-shades, reduced dye yields, or issues with dye application. Therefore, sourcing from reputable manufacturers, preferably those with certifications like ISO, GMP, or SGS, is highly recommended. These certifications often indicate a commitment to rigorous quality control processes.
